titleOfInvention a filter having a super water-repellent and super oil-repellent function and a device for preparation thereof
abstract The present invention relates to a filter body to which super water-repellent and super-oil-repellent functions are imparted, and an apparatus for manufacturing the same. The filter body is a glass fiber filter; Foam coating and dry PTFE foam coating layer with a foam coating solution for PTFE foam coating on the surface of the glass fiber filter to a certain thickness; A PTFE fiber layer in which a solution containing PTFE and PVA is electrospun on the surface of the PTFE foam coating layer to volatilize PVA fibers and adhere only the PTFE fibers; And after forming a PTFE powder layer sprayed by the electrostatic spraying method on the surface of the PTFE foam coating layer to which the PTFE fibers are attached, the PTFE foam coating layer is cured. The super water-repellent and super-oil-repellent filter bodies according to the present invention have excellent dedusting efficiency and can be used as a filter body for removing sticky dust in exhaust gas of industrial processes.
